Win10虚拟机卡顿原因揭秘
win10虚拟机好卡是什么原因

首页 2025-02-03 04:55:25



Win10虚拟机运行卡顿的原因深度解析与优化策略 在数字化时代,虚拟机技术以其强大的功能性和灵活性,成为众多用户解决操作系统兼容性、软件测试与开发、系统隔离保护等问题的首选工具

    Windows 10作为广泛应用的操作系统,其内置的Hyper-V虚拟化功能,以及诸如VMware Workstation、Oracle VM VirtualBox等第三方虚拟机软件,为用户提供了多样化的虚拟机解决方案

    然而,不少用户在使用过程中发现,Win10虚拟机运行时常出现卡顿现象,这严重影响了工作效率和体验

    本文将深入探讨Win10虚拟机卡顿的原因,并提出相应的优化策略,帮助用户解决这一问题

     一、Win10虚拟机卡顿的主要原因 1.资源分配不合理 虚拟机运行时需要消耗大量的计算机硬件资源,包括CPU、内存、硬盘和网络等

    若分配给虚拟机的资源过少,将无法满足其运行需求,导致卡顿现象

    反之,若资源分配过多,则可能造成资源浪费,甚至给宿主机带来压力

    因此,资源分配不合理是虚拟机卡顿的主要原因之一

     在Win10虚拟机中,CPU资源尤为关键

    若虚拟机未获得足够的CPU核心数或线程数,将直接影响其处理能力和响应速度

    内存分配同样重要,内存不足会导致虚拟机频繁进行内存交换,从而拖慢运行速度

    此外,硬盘的读写速度也是影响虚拟机性能的关键因素,使用传统的机械硬盘(HDD)相较于固态硬盘(SSD)会有明显的性能差距

     2.驱动程序不匹配 虚拟机中安装的驱动程序与宿主机中的驱动程序不匹配,或者未安装专门为虚拟机优化的驱动程序,都可能导致硬件设备无法正常工作或性能低下

    在Win10虚拟机中,这种不匹配可能表现为图形显示异常、网络连接不稳定、音频输出卡顿等问题

     3.软件冲突 宿主机或虚拟机中安装的一些不兼容或冲突的软件,如杀毒软件、防火墙、加速器等,可能干扰虚拟机的正常运行

    这些软件可能会阻止虚拟机与硬件或网络的正常通信,或占用大量系统资源,从而导致虚拟机卡顿

     4.虚拟化技术不支持 Intel VT-x和AMD-V等虚拟化技术能够使虚拟机直接访问硬件资源,实现接近原生系统的运行效率

    若宿主机的CPU不支持这些虚拟化技术,或虚拟化技术未开启,虚拟机则需要通过软件模拟来访问硬件资源,这将大大降低其运行速度

     5.虚拟机软件版本过低 虚拟机软件版本过低可能导致与宿主机系统或虚拟机系统间存在兼容性问题,或无法支持一些新的特性和功能

    这同样可能导致虚拟机运行不稳定或卡顿

     6.虚拟机系统未优化 虚拟机系统中一些不必要的程序、服务、扩展或动画效果等,都会占用系统资源和性能

    若未对这些进行适当优化,将影响虚拟机的运行速度

     二、Win10虚拟机卡顿的优化策略 针对上述原因,我们可以采取以下优化策略来提升Win10虚拟机的性能: 1.合理分配资源 根据虚拟机运行的操作系统和软件的需求,合理地为其分配资源

    对于CPU,建议分配给虚拟机至少2个核心,但不超过宿主机CPU核心数的一半

    对于内存,至少分配2GB,但不超过宿主机内存总容量的一半

    同时,建议使用SSD作为虚拟硬盘,以提高读写速度

     2.开启虚拟化技术 检查宿主机的CPU是否支持虚拟化技术,如Intel VT-x和AMD-V

    若支持,则进入BIOS设置中开启虚拟化技术

    这将使虚拟机能够直接访问硬件资源,提高运行速度

     3.更新和优化驱动程序 尝试安装一些专门为虚拟机优化的驱动程序,如VMware Tools或VirtualBox Guest Additions等

    这些驱动程序可以提高虚拟机的图形、音频、网络和鼠标等设备的性能

    同时,确保宿主机和虚拟机中的驱动程序都是最新版本,以避免因版本不匹配导致的性能问题

     4.排除软件冲突 检查宿主机或虚拟机中是否安装了一些不兼容或导致冲突的软件

    特别是一些可能影响虚拟机运行的软件,如杀毒软件、加速器等

    可以暂时退出或卸载这些软件,以观察虚拟机性能是否有所提升

     5.升级虚拟机软件 若虚拟机软件版本过低,建议升级到最新版本

    新版本通常修复了旧版本中的漏洞和性能问题,并增加了新的特性和功能

    这将有助于提升虚拟机的稳定性和性能

     6.优化虚拟机系统 根据虚拟机系统的类型,尝试优化系统

    例如,关闭不需要的程序、服务、扩展或动画效果等

    这可以减少系统资源的占用,提高虚拟机的运行速度

     7.使用快照功能 虚拟机软件通常提供快照功能,可以保存虚拟机的当前状态

    在进行系统更新、软件安装或配置更改前,可以先创建快照

    这样,在出现问题时可以快速恢复到之前的状态,避免因配置错误或系统崩溃导致的虚拟机卡顿

     8.监控和调整性能 使用虚拟机软件提供的性能监控工具,实时监控虚拟机的CPU、内存、硬盘和网络等资源的使用情况

    根据监控结果,适时调整资源分配或优化系统配置,以保持虚拟机的最佳性能

     三、结语 Win10虚拟机卡顿是一个复杂的问题,涉及资源分配、驱动程序匹配、软件冲突、虚拟化技术支持、虚拟机软件版本以及虚拟机系统优化等多个方面

    通过本文的深度解析和优化策略,我们可以找到导致虚拟机卡顿的根本原因,并采取相应的优化措施来提升其性能

    无论是对于个人用户还是小型企业而言,优化后的Win10虚拟机都将为软件开发与测试、教学与培训、数据安全与隔离以及旧版软件运行等应用场景提供更加高效和稳定的解决方案

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道